29 | French and Spanish but others too, including home languages. Reading, listening & potentially speaking practice. | Ideas for language lessons incorporating World's Largest Lesson: 1. 35-minute lesson in English - you can add Fr/Sp subtitles for reading practice: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=Yu8Lrg4lR8U 2. 6-min animation from 5 years ago (introduced by Malala) with same animation on RH side in various languages incl. Fr, Sp & Russian for listening: https://vimeo.com/138852758 3. World’s Largest Lesson videos from over the years in lots of languages from Yoruba to Welsh to Urdu: https://vimeo.com/worldslargestlesson 4. Extension: students create own video response in a curriculum or home language to show in an assembly. | https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=Yu8Lrg4lR8U | |||||||||||||||||||||||
